1. Enhancing Oral Health with Implants

Dental implants significantly improve oral health by replacing missing teeth, allowing individuals to regain normal chewing function. When a tooth is lost, the surrounding teeth can drift out of alignment, leading to further dental issues. Implants serve as sturdy anchors for prosthetic teeth, preventing dental drift and maintaining the structure of the mouth.
Additionally, dental implants promote better oral hygiene. Unlike dentures, which can be difficult to clean, implants can be brushed and flossed just like natural teeth. This ease of maintenance reduces the risk of plaque buildup and subsequent gum disease, enhancing overall oral health.
Moreover, implants offer a solution for jawbone deterioration caused by missing teeth. Implants stimulate the jawbone, preventing resorption and maintaining facial structure. This benefit not only aids in oral health but also preserves the aesthetics of the face, reducing the appearance of sagging or aging.
2. Boosting Confidence through Restored Smiles
One of the most significant psychological benefits of dental implants is the boost in self-confidence that comes with having a complete smile. Individuals who have lost teeth often experience embarrassment or self-consciousness, which can hinder social interactions and impact their quality of life.
With dental implants, patients can regain their ability to smile freely and engage in conversations without fear of judgment. This restored confidence can lead to improved social interactions, enhanced professional opportunities, and a more active social life.
Furthermore, the aesthetic appeal of dental implants cannot be understated. They are designed to look and feel like natural teeth, allowing individuals to eat, speak, and smile with ease. This natural appearance plays a crucial role in enhancing a persons overall demeanor and self-esteem.
3. Understanding the Implant Procedure
The dental implant procedure begins with a comprehensive evaluation, including imaging studies to assess bone health and suitability for implants. Once a treatment plan is determined, the procedure typically involves surgically placing a titanium post into the jawbone. This post acts as the root of the new tooth, providing a solid foundation.
After the surgical placement, a healing period follows, during which osseointegration occurs. This process allows the implant to fuse with the bone, providing stability. Following this healing phase, an abutment and crown are attached, completing the restoration.
Patients often find the procedure less daunting than anticipated. Anesthesia ensures comfort during the surgery, and advancements in dental techniques have made the process quicker and more efficient. Post-operative care is straightforward, typically involving mild pain management and routine follow-up visits to ensure successful healing.
4. Innovations in Dental Implant Technology
The field of dental implants has experienced significant technological advancements in recent years, improving treatment outcomes. Innovations such as 3D imaging and computer-guided implant placement enhance precision and reduce procedural errors. These technologies ensure that implants are placed at optimal angles and depths, promoting better integration with the bone.
Additionally, the development of biocompatible materials for implants has improved their longevity and success rates. Modern implant designs are tailored to promote faster healing and more effective osseointegration, ensuring a higher success rate for patients worldwide.
Furthermore, digital dentistry has introduced advancements in designing dental prosthetics. Custom-made crowns can now be created using CAD/CAM technology, enabling a faster turnaround and ensuring that each restoration beautifully matches the patients natural teeth.
